Nature of request
The prior and convent of Durham request that the king support their efforts to secure the appropriation of the church of Hemingbrough, for which they were given leave by his grandfather Edward [I] and by him, bearing in mind the great poverty they suffer as a result of the appropriation of Simonburn church to the king's free chapel of Windsor and the loss of their cell of Coldingham to the Scots.

Note
Datable from internal references to the very end of the reign of Edward III: see Fraser, Northern Petitions, pp. 195-7.
